四时宝库

程序员的知识宝库

使用Docker部署nextjs应用(docker搭建nextcloud)

最近使用nextjs网站开发,希望使用docker进行生产环境的部署,减少环境的依赖可重复部署操作。我采用的是Dockerfile编写应用镜像方式+ docker-compose实现容器部署的功能。

Docker

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口(类似 iPhone 的 app),更重要的是容器性能开销极低。我们可以通过将开发代码打包到docker 镜像中,上传到docker hub中,待发布时通过拉取docker hub镜像启动docker 容器,实现代码运行环境的高度一致,并提高部署效率。

Docker安装Jenkins打包Maven项目为Docker镜像并运行「图文教学」

一、前言

Jenkins作为CI、CD的先驱者,虽然现在的风头没有Gitlab强了,但是还是老当益壮,很多中小公司还是使用比较广泛的。最近小编经历了一次Jenkins发包,感觉还不错,所以自己学习了一下。网上比较多的教程都是在Linux上搭建Jenkins,小编经过一个星期的探索终于完成了在docker中进行搭建。

Docker新手福音!这个开源控制面板让你更快上手Docker

Docker 是目前一种非常主流的容器化方案,支持非常多的特性,给开发者带来便利,但是 Docker 镜像以及容器管理复杂的参数让许多新手望而却步。

今天马建仓为各位推荐的这个项目就是一款可视化程度更高的 Docker 控制面板,一起来看看吧。

项目名称: SimpleDocker

项目作者: Taoes

开源许可协议: GPL-2.0## 二级标题

新手快速入门Docker,轻松掌握Docker安装与使用

安装

使用官方安装脚本自动安装

Docker 1.13 管理命令(docker管理系统)

1.12 CLI 的问题

Docker1.12 命令行接口(CLI)有40多个顶级命令,这些命令存在以下问题:

  1. 没有归类组织,这让docker 新手很难学习;

  2. 有些命令没有提供足够的上下文环境,以至于我们不知道是在操作image 还是container(eg:docker inspect);这种在 image和 container 之间混合使用的命令让人困惑;

「048」Docker:命令行介绍及容器操作

这一篇文章我将和大家一起快速地入门 Docker 的命令行(CLI)基本结构,和一些常用的容器操作,比如容器的创建、停止和删除等。

TrueNAS环境搭建(三)Docker容器应用NextCLoud&MINIO

TrueNAS SCALE版本支持docker容器应用,以下是TrueNAS自带的容器应用,可以在正常联网情况下直接进行安装部署。


一、NextCloud应用

docker 运维使用技巧(一)(docker运行操作系统)

docker 运维使用技巧(一)

1.brctl 命令未找到

yum -y install bridge-utils


2.启动

docker run -idt --net=none --name test1 centos:latest /bin/bash

容器化之Docker镜像仓库Harbor的安装

前置环境Docker Compose的安装

Docker Compose是用来定义和运行多个Docker应用程序的工具。通过Compose,可以使用YAML文件来配置应用程序需要的所有服务,然后使用一个命令即可从YML文件配置中创建并启动所有服务。

docker可视化管理工具推荐!docker.ui

大家好,我是开源探索者,持续分享开源项目,关注技术的最新动态,分享自己的经验和见解。

<< 1 2 3 4 > >>
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言
    友情链接